site stats

Linkage function python

Nettet6 timer siden · Tried to add custom function to Python's recordlinkage library but getting KeyError: 0. Within the custom function I'm calculating only token_set_ratio of two strings. import recordlinkage indexer = recordlinkage.Index () indexer.sortedneighbourhood (left_on='desc', right_on='desc') full_candidate_links = indexer.index (df_a, df_b) from ... NettetThe R base function cophenetic() can be used to compute the cophenetic distances for hierarchical clustering. # Compute cophentic distance res.coph <- cophenetic(res.hc) # Correlation between cophenetic distance and # the original distance cor(res.dist, res.coph) ## [1] 0.698. Execute the hclust() function again using the average linkage method.

scipy.cluster.hierarchy.linkage — SciPy v0.14.0 Reference …

Nettetwould calculate the pair-wise distances between the vectors in X using the Python function sokalsneath. This would result in sokalsneath being called ( n 2) times, which … Nettetlinkage (y[, method, metric, optimal_ordering]) Perform hierarchical/agglomerative clustering. single (y) Perform single/min/nearest linkage on the condensed distance … how do shareholders affect a business https://bulkfoodinvesting.com

Hierarchical Clustering – LearnDataSci

Nettet14. feb. 2016 · Methods which are most frequently used in studies where clusters are expected to be solid more or less round clouds, - are methods of average linkage, complete linkage method, and Ward's method. Ward's method is the closest, by it properties and efficiency, to K-means clustering; they share the same objective … Nettet12. sep. 2024 · Linkage decides how the distance between clusters, or point to cluster distance is computed. Commonly used linkage mechanisms are outlined below: Single … NettetThe hierarchical clustering encoded with the matrix returned by the linkage function. tscalar For criteria ‘inconsistent’, ‘distance’ or ‘monocrit’, this is the threshold to apply … how do shared wells work

2. Comparing — Python Record Linkage Toolkit 0.15 …

Category:Hierarchical Clustering in Python [Concepts and Analysis]

Tags:Linkage function python

Linkage function python

Agglomerative Hierarchical Clustering - Datanovia

NettetThe linkage criterion determines which distance to use between sets of observation. The algorithm will merge the pairs of cluster that minimize this criterion. ‘ward’ minimizes the variance of the clusters being merged. … Nettet15. des. 2024 · Average Linkage: This method computes the distance between two clusters by finding all possible dissimilarities between the two clusters. All the dissimilarities are then averaged, and the average value is then taken as …

Linkage function python

Did you know?

Nettet6 timer siden · import recordlinkage indexer = recordlinkage.Index () indexer.sortedneighbourhood (left_on='desc', right_on='desc') full_candidate_links = … Nettet15. des. 2024 · Centroid linkage: This method involves centering each cluster and then measuring the distance between the obtained centers of the two clusters. Ward’s Minimum variance method: Ward distance is one of the better metrics for …

NettetCompute the linkage between all of the different points. Here we use a simple euclidean distance measure and Ward's linkage, which seeks to minimize the variance between clusters. linkage_data = linkage (data, method='ward', metric='euclidean') Finally, plot the results in a dendrogram. NettetThe main observations to make are: single linkage is fast, and can perform well on non-globular data, but it performs poorly in the presence of noise. average and complete …

Nettet31. mar. 2024 · The first line of the code recordlinkage.Index() is a class that will be used to create record pairs based on the different algorithms. Currently, three algorithms … Nettetlinkage: [noun] the manner or style of being united: such as. the manner in which atoms or radicals are linked in a molecule. bond 3c.

Nettet23. apr. 2012 · I had search about MathLink but how to use it in Python is a little obscure to me. I tried to use a Mathematica-Python library called pyml but I hadn't no sucess, maybe because this lib looks very old (in tutorial says Mathematica 2 or 3). So, someone knows a good way to write python programs who uses Mathematica functions and …

NettetCompute the linkage between all of the different points. Here we use a simple euclidean distance measure and Ward's linkage, which seeks to minimize the variance between … how do shared secured loans workNettet1. okt. 2024 · The Python Record Linkage Toolkit provides the indexing modules to create the pairing of records which simplified the process. There are several indexing … how do shareholders make moneyNettet29. mar. 2024 · There are mainly two types of functions in Python. Built-in library function: These are Standard functions in Python that are available to use. User-defined function: We can create our own functions based on our requirements. Creating a function in Python We can create a Python function using the def keyword. Python3 … how do shareholders help a businessNettet31. mar. 2024 · The first line of the code recordlinkage.Index() is a class that will be used to create record pairs based on the different algorithms. Currently, three algorithms are incorporated — full, block, and sortedneighbourhood. Full In the below example we are using the full index algorithm for indexing. how much schooling do you need for pharmacistNettetExample in python Let’s take a look at a concrete example of how we could go about labelling data using hierarchical agglomerative clustering. import pandas as pd import numpy as np from matplotlib import pyplot as plt from sklearn.cluster import AgglomerativeClustering import scipy.cluster.hierarchy as sch how do sharepoint and teams relateNettet14. aug. 2024 · We would be using the AgglomerativeClustering function from the sklearn.clustering module. from sklearn.cluster import AgglomerativeClustering. cluster = AgglomerativeClustering(n_clusters=2, affinity=’euclidean’, linkage=’ward’) cluster.fit_predict(X) Here, we do specify the clusters, which is not a hyperparameter. how do sharepoint and onedrive work togetherNettetComparing — Python Record Linkage Toolkit 0.15 documentation. 2. Comparing ¶. A set of informative, discriminating and independent features is important for a good classification of record pairs into matching and distinct pairs. The recordlinkage.Compare class and its methods can be used to compare records pairs. how do sharepoint calendars work